Job Description:Role Summary/Purpose:The VP, Executive Protection (EP) Specialist will be part of Synchrony’s Executive Protection Team that is responsible for providing personnel security and safety for Synchrony’s Executive Leadership Team (ELT). This will be done through a collaborative effort with the Operations and Logistical Planning, and Intelligence and Investigations Teams. The VP, EP will assist in conducting threat assessments, develop comprehensive protection plans, execute on the protection plans to include conducting advanced security reviews and executing the protective security during domestic and international travel.
This role will primarily be based in Fairfield County, CT.Essential Responsibilities:
Threat Assessment and Risk Mitigation: Utilizing in-depth risk assessments and intelligence, identify potential threats, vulnerabilities, and security gaps, developing and implementing proactive security protection strategies to address them.
Protection Detail: Provide physical security to the executive through preparation, detection and response to passive and active threats. Includes coordination with event and destination security, close monitoring of the client’s surroundings to ensure a protective perimeter, and intervening in any suspicious or threatening situations.
Surveillance Detection: Actively identifying and tracking potential surveillance efforts, maintaining awareness of surroundings to detect suspicious activity.
Travel Security: Planning and coordinating secure travel arrangements, including route planning, advance security checks of locations, and managing transportation logistics.
Event Security: Assessing and securing event venues, managing access control, coordinating with local security personnel, identifying safe ingress and egress and ensuring client safety during public appearances.
Incident Response: Reacting swiftly and effectively to any security incidents, coordinating with emergency services if necessary, and de-escalating tense situations.
Liaison and Communication: Maintaining open communication with client/event security teams, law enforcement, Synchrony contracted security and other relevant stakeholders.
Physical Fitness and Firearms Proficiency: Maintaining a high level of physical fitness and proficiency with firearms, as required by regulations and specific situations.
Other Responsibilities as deemed necessary to the security mission.
